My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

Champ Chance, who largely goes by Chance, was rescued from the streets of Van Nuys as a kitten and has lived with the same owner since 2016. He is playful and friendly, but does not always want to be touched. He would thrive in an environment that allows him to climb, perch, play, and explore. He would likely do best in a single cat household. He has lived with a dog previously, however he and the dog largely avoided one another and did not have any conflicts. When stressed, or left alone for long periods he can engage in marking behavior. His current owner’s living situation has changed leaving him with limited space and attention, and the situation is no longer the best environment for him. Chance needs a new home that he can thrive and be his best self in.
